Transaction 3f93bb6ba74bcd07ef5fc696659701f6a4262f33aadc844c11765b394cb6b682
1 Input
1 Output
-
3f93bb6ba74bcd07ef5fc696659701f6a4262f33aadc844c11765b394cb6b682:0
- value
- 1323700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d14b0fde80ec09dca0fd0ea0b00c1805a7aa044 OP_EQUAL
- address
- 32tBVhXAmzXbLFWetbkQ9kh1QaLWz6x4TM